Output d63bc7448dabac81532b585400a725438d33dee8dca57b83e3a21e76d7bbde99:1

value
60750000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 734b16ec2d3dfb0da76213cc5a2130ec436eec8e OP_EQUAL
address
3CCdav9CBUgxAE1YHvq9giDryTdqGCNPN9
transaction
d63bc7448dabac81532b585400a725438d33dee8dca57b83e3a21e76d7bbde99
confirmations
405761
spent
true